Chatir-Dag
Chatyr-Dag is a mountain massif in the Crimean Mountains, the fifth highest in the region. Its highest point is the peak of Eklizi-Burun (1527 m), the second is Angar-Burun (1453 m). The most convenient entrance here leads through the Angar pass, from where you can climb both the lower and upper plateau.
The main attraction of the lower plateau is the equipped caves: Marmurova, Emine-Bair-Khosar and Emine-Bair-Koba. And from the upper plateau there are wide views of half of the Crimea. It is not for nothing that Chatyr-Dag is called the kingdom of caves: there are more than 200 cavities and more than a thousand karst sinkholes - the highest density among all Crimean mountains.
The massif is popular: only the lower plateau is visited by at least 40 thousand people a year. The warm half of the year is the most convenient for caves and walks on the plateau, because in winter it is cold and windy up there.
